Catherine LEDUC was born 15 December 1775 in L'Assomption, Province of Québec, Canada

Catherine LEDUC was the child of Antoine LEDUC   and   Catherine POITRAS and the grandchild of: (paternal)  Antoine LEDUC and Jeanne FAUTEUX (maternal)  Francois POITRAS and Marguerite HAINS

Spouse(s)/Partner(s) and Child(ren):

Catherine  married  Toussaint-Robert CAVELIER (LECAVALIER) 26 January 1796 in L'Assomption, Lower Canada .  The couple had (at least) 1 child.
Toussaint-Robert CAVELIER (LECAVALIER)  was born 7 June 1772 in Montréal, Québec, Canada (Sault-au-Récollet) (Côte-St-Michel) (Côte-St-Paul).  Toussaint-Robert died 26 March 1839 in Contrecœur, Québec, Canada (Sainte-Trinité-de-Contrecoeur).  Toussaint-Robert was the child of Guillaume CAVELIER (LECAVELIER) and Marie-Josephe PICARD dite HUPPÉ.

Catherine LEDUC died 20 March 1831 in Contrecœur, Lower Canada .

Did You Know? Québec Généalogie - Over time, Québec has gone through a series of name changes
From its inception in the early 1600s until 1760, it was called Canada, New France.
1760 to 1763, it was simply Canada
1763 to 1791 - Province of Québec
1791 to 1867 - Lower Canada
1867 to present - Québec, Canada.
